Handover — Vexler partner SFTP drop

Ownership moves to you today. Drop runs hourly from Vexler's end into the intake bucket via the relay host. Watch for zero-byte files; their exporter flakes on Mondays. Creds live in the ops vault, path noted in the runbook. Vault auto-seals after 48h idle. Support escalations go to the on-call rotation, not me. If the vault is sealed when you need it, unseal with the recovery passphrase below.

recovery phrase for tadug-fafof: zorwyn-kasion

Ticket: PointsLedger vault locked — release blocked

Vault sealing job misfired overnight; the Torvane loyalty-points ledger signing keys are now inaccessible. Tonight's 2.9 release can't be cut until the vault is unsealed. Audit logging is confirmed active. Ops signed off on a one-time manual unseal for this release window. Unseal using the passphrase below, then kick off the build.

unlock words, kawig-fawig: frawyn-soriel-ralok-casdor-sorwyn-casdor-novdor-kasvan-siliel-aldath-feniel-ulaath-zorwyn

/*
 * Client setup for the Hallwhisper audio-guide backend.
 * This client streams exhibit narration manifests from the internal
 * Curiohall content service. Note for new contractors: do not use
 * the public visitor endpoint here — the app needs the internal one,
 * which requires service-level authentication on every request.
 * Timeouts are set to 5s because gallery Wi-Fi is unreliable.
 * Initialize the client with the service key provided below.
 */

app token of kaduf-hagug = vxb4-Q0rH

**Q: Why did template rendering slow down in the 4.2 release candidate?**

A: The Quillstone renderer now compiles templates per-locale instead of caching one variant. First render per locale is ~3x slower; subsequent renders are faster. Don't block the release on it. If staging numbers look wrong, the perf dashboard may just be stale — force a cache flush from the Quillstone admin panel. The flush endpoint is gated; when prompted, enter the recovery passphrase below.

vault phrase of tajop-haduf = holath-brivan-wenax